Abstract

 In classical systems, when the volume occupied by a free particle expands, positive work is always done on the surroundings. However, under the same conditions, the expansion of a quantum system does not necessarily result in positive work; this depends on the speed of the expansion. This paper explores the characteristics of the work output during the finite uniform expansion of the walls of an infinite potential well. The calculations show that the faster the walls of the potential well move, the smaller the total work output.
